States that no labor organization or employer shall be required to furnish, directly or indirectly, to the employer, in the case of a labor organization, or to the labor organization, in the case of an employer, materials, information, time, premises, meeting places, bulletin boards or other facilities to enable such other party to communicate with or reply to any communication with employees of the employer, members of the labor organization, its supporters or adherents. (Amends 29 U.S.C. 158(c))
Introduced in Senate
Referred to Senate Committee on Labor and Public Welfare.
